Study on the genetic characteristics and molecular epidemiology of Echovirus 11 strains isolated from patients with hand food and mouth disease in He-nan province, China / 中华微生物学和免疫学杂志

ABSTRACT
Objective To analyze the evolution and genetic characteristics of Echovirus 11 (Echo11) strains isolated from patients with hand food and mouth disease ( HFMD) in Henan province. Methods Enterovirus strains were isolated from stool samples of patients with HFMD from year 2010 to 2012.The sequences of VP1 region of all positive strains were amplified , sequenced and then analyzed by BLSAT to determine their genotypes .The entire VP1 coding regions of 10 Echo11 strains were amplified by RT-PCR, and the homology analysis was conducted among them and other Echo 11 strains published in Gen-Bank.A phylogenetic tree was constructed to evaluate the evolution of Henan isolates and the prevalence of different genotypes .Results From year 2010 to 2012 , 184 non-Enterovirus 71 ( EV71 ) strains and non-Coxsakievirus A16 (CA16) strains causing HFMD were isolated, 10 (5.43%) of with were Echo11 strains. There were 876 nucleotides ( nt) in the complete VP1 gene sequence , encoding 292 amino acids ( aa) .The 10 Echo11 strains shared 93.1%-100% homologies in nt sequences and 97.3%-100% in aa sequences. The homology analysis indicated that Henan strains and prototype strains were highly similar but different with the homology of 77.8%-78.8% in nt and 90.8%-91.8% in aa, respectively.Conclusion Echo11 was one of the pathogens causing HFMD in He-nan province and genotype A was the dominant genotype .
